At the request of JIPM, Japan, the British Standards Body has published a PAS (Publicly Available Specification), which is a little short of being an international standard. This standard, is termed PAS 1918:2022-Total productive maintenance (TPM). Implementing key performance indicators. It is issued in July 2022. It fills out a dire need to have some universally accepted concepts, metrics, and implementation strategies for applying TPM to the industry.

The need for the standard comes from the fact that each industry was following the methodology given by their external consultant, called Counsellors. These counselors depend heavily on their past experience in their own industries where they did implement TPM. As the companies are various and each company is different, the TPM concept itself was different in different plants. Even the counselors from JIPM could not resolve differences, as they have their own individualistic version of TPM.

As you are aware, Total productive maintenance (TPM) emerged in Japan in the early 1970s as a maintenance system for maximizing production efficiency in the automotive supply chain. Since then, its popularity has spread across many other manufacturing industries. Even process industries also have tried to adopt the concepts and created their own version of TPM, suitable to specific needs of process plants. From its beginnings in Japan, TPM quickly grew. Over the next half century word of its effectiveness spread, resulting in its much wider adoption globally and across many different industries.

Problem was that while numerous organizations have adopted the TPM approach, they’ve not always done so correctly. Now PAS 1918:2022 has been published to supply authoritative guidance on how to implement TPM.

It gives guidance on the concept of total productive maintenance (TPM) and the key performance indicators (KPIs) that are relevant to implementing it. Guidance is provided on TPM for manufacturing plants and equipment.

Some of the features of iSO-2018-2022 are as follows:

  1. It defines basic concepts of TPM that avoid confusion prevailing in the industry. Various consultants have their own definitions and understanding of terms. The standard promotes common parlance all across the industry.
  2. It defines Metrics that show the progress and achievement of the TPM campaign in a company. It offers a common platform to compare the achievement of several industries on a common platform and provides a way forward in terms of what more is to be achieved.
  3.  Written in collaboration with JIPM, which has systematized and spread tPM concepts all over the world. Therefore, it provides authenticity.
  4. Consultants can objectively assess and discuss the progress of TPM and can tell the industry what else is needed to be done.
  5. It is a stepping stone to a wider world standard like ISO, which will have acceptability around the globe. A more professional approach is possible to be adopted in Industry.
  6. It can be used as a training tool for enhanced understanding and learning of the TPM concept, thereby reducing dependence on external experts and consultants.
  7. With this standard, it is expected that more industries would be interested in the concept of TPM and will implement it.

BRIEF INTRODUCTION TO THE CONTENTS OF THE STANDARD

1. SCOPE

This PAS gives guidance on the concept of TPM and the key performance indicators (KPIs) that are relevant to implementing it. Guidance is provided on TPM for manufacturing plants and equipment.
The PAS is relevant to any organization in the discrete parts manufacturing industries and process industries. It is intended for persons involved in the operation and/or maintenance of plants and equipment, or persons working in the manufacturing department, the quality department, the maintenance department, the production department, the supply chain, etc.

NOTE 1 This PAS sets out the basics of TPM as described in IATF 16949 for companies seeking IATF (International Automotive Task Force) certification, and does not preclude the expansion of the scope of application or the introduction of new technologies based on these basics.

This PAS does not cover specific issues with the lean manufacturing method and JIT or TQC.

NOTE 2 This PAS has adopted gender-neutral language; specifically, using the term “worker” instead of “man”.
